With the standard arms the car was really twitchy to drive, pretty much change lanes on it's own on the freeway, scary shit, we tried everything from 65mm spacers on the front of them to 65mm spacers where the front ALK would go and a million other things including about 4 wheel alignments, obviously putting the lift kit in had shortened the wheelbase and the rear wheels were way too close to the front of the rear guard so as a last option we got 4 rear arms and cut them so when they were joined they were about an inch longer, then they were boxed in for extra strength, I told him this had been done along with everything else over about 100 fucking emails, he even had a mechanic come inspect the car and he couldn't fault it, in fact absolutely loved it, so when it arrived in QLD it had to be regoed and he had Al from A & M Auto's do work needed but I think that's where the problem stemmed from, the buyer was a pedantic prick but I got my cash and couldn't help him so fuck him.
